基于Spark的实时日志分析案例研究课程设计_第1页
基于Spark的实时日志分析案例研究课程设计_第2页
基于Spark的实时日志分析案例研究课程设计_第3页
基于Spark的实时日志分析案例研究课程设计_第4页
基于Spark的实时日志分析案例研究课程设计_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

基于Spark的实时日志分析案例研究课程设计1.甲方(买方/出租方/委托方):

甲方名称:XX大学计算机科学与技术学院;

甲方地址:XX省XX市XX区XX路XX号XX大学计算机科学与技术学院;

甲方法定代表人/负责人:张三;

甲方联系方式

2.乙方(卖方/承租方/服务提供方):

乙方名称:XX科技有限公司;

乙方地址:XX省XX市XX区XX路XX号XX科技有限公司;

乙方法定代表人/负责人:李四;

乙方联系方式

**合同简介**

本合同由甲方与乙方就“基于Spark的实时日志分析案例研究课程设计”项目达成合作,旨在通过乙方的技术支持与资源投入,结合甲方的学术需求与教学目标,共同完成一项具有实践性与创新性的课程设计项目。甲方作为教育机构,致力于提升学生的实际操作能力与数据分析技能,而乙方作为专业技术服务提供商,拥有丰富的Spark平台开发经验与数据处理技术,能够为甲方提供高质量的课程设计支持。双方基于平等互利、诚实信用的原则,通过本合同的签订,明确各自的权利与义务,确保项目的顺利实施与完成。

项目的背景在于当前大数据时代对数据分析人才的需求日益增长,而Spark作为业界领先的实时数据处理框架,其应用场景广泛且技术复杂度高,需要通过系统化的课程设计帮助学生掌握核心技能。甲方在课程教学中面临技术资源不足与实战案例缺乏的挑战,而乙方具备完善的技术服务体系与行业经验,能够为甲方提供定制化的课程设计解决方案。因此,双方合作不仅能够满足甲方的教学需求,也能够帮助乙方拓展教育服务市场,实现资源共享与价值共赢。

在合作过程中,甲方将提供课程的基本框架与教学要求,乙方则负责设计具体的案例研究内容、开发实验环境与提供技术指导,双方通过定期沟通与协调,确保项目进度与质量符合预期标准。本合同明确了双方在项目实施过程中的责任分工、费用结算方式、违约处理机制等内容,为项目的顺利推进提供法律保障。通过本合同的履行,甲方能够获得一套完整的、可落地的课程设计方案,而乙方则能够积累教育服务领域的成功案例,提升市场竞争力。双方的合作基础牢固,合作前景广阔,本合同旨在为双方的长期合作奠定坚实基础。

第一条合同目的与范围

本合同的主要目的在于通过甲方与乙方的合作,共同完成“基于Spark的实时日志分析案例研究课程设计”项目,旨在为甲方提供一套系统性、实践性强的课程设计方案,帮助学生掌握Spark平台的实时数据处理能力与日志分析技术。项目涉及的具体内容包括:

1.**课程框架设计**:乙方根据甲方提供的初步需求,设计课程的整体框架,包括课程目标、知识体系、能力要求等;

2.**案例研究开发**:乙方开发多个基于Spark的实时日志分析案例,涵盖数据采集、清洗、处理、可视化等环节,并结合实际业务场景进行讲解;

3.**实验环境搭建**:乙方提供课程所需的实验环境配置方案,包括软件安装、硬件要求、网络环境等,并确保环境稳定性与兼容性;

4.**技术指导与培训**:乙方为甲方教师提供技术培训,讲解Spark的核心功能与案例操作要点,确保教师能够顺利开展教学;

5.**课程材料交付**:乙方完成课程设计后,向甲方交付完整的课程材料,包括PPT、实验手册、代码示例、参考资料等,并配合甲方进行后续的修改与完善。

本合同的范围限定于上述内容的开发与交付,不包括课程实施后的学生考核、师资培训以外的技术服务,以及因第三方原因导致的额外需求变更。双方应严格按照合同约定履行职责,确保项目成果符合教学标准与市场需求。

第二条定义

在本合同中,下列术语具有以下含义:

1.**Spark平台**:指由ApacheSoftwareFoundation开发的分布式计算框架,用于大规模数据处理、实时分析及机器学习等应用;

2.**实时日志分析**:指通过Spark技术对动态产生的日志数据进行快速处理、统计与挖掘,以获取业务洞察或系统性能指标;

3.**案例研究**:指乙方设计的具有实际业务背景的实验项目,通过具体案例帮助学生理解Spark技术的应用逻辑与操作流程;

4.**课程材料**:包括课程设计文档、实验手册、代码库、教学PPT等所有与课程相关的交付物;

5.**技术指导**:指乙方为甲方教师提供的Spark平台使用培训,涵盖核心功能讲解、问题解答与操作演示;

6.**交付标准**:指课程材料需满足的格式、内容完整性及技术准确性要求,具体标准由双方在合同附件中明确。

上述定义是双方理解与执行本合同的基础,任何一方不得随意变更术语含义,如需调整需经双方书面确认。

第三条双方权利与义务

**1.甲方的权力与义务**

(1)**权力**:

-甲方有权对乙方的课程设计方案进行审核,并提出修改意见,乙方应积极配合调整;

-甲方有权要求乙方按照约定时间交付课程材料,并监督交付成果的质量;

-甲方有权在课程实施过程中,根据实际需求对部分案例内容进行微调,但需提前书面通知乙方,并承担由此产生的额外费用。

(2)**义务**:

-甲方应向乙方提供课程设计的初步需求,包括教学目标、学生背景、课时安排等关键信息;

-甲方应按时支付合同款项,并配合乙方完成课程材料的验收工作;

-甲方应确保乙方在校园内的实验环境搭建符合学校安全与合规要求,并对因甲方原因导致的设备故障或数据泄露承担责任;

-甲方应指定专门对接人,负责与乙方的日常沟通与协调,确保项目信息传递的及时性与准确性。

**2.乙方的权力与义务**

(1)**权力**:

-乙方有权要求甲方提供必要的课程需求细节与技术支持,确保设计方案的科学性与可行性;

-乙方有权根据合同约定收取项目款项,并要求甲方在逾期时支付违约金;

-乙方有权拒绝执行甲方提出的超出合同范围的额外需求,并需书面说明理由。

(2)**义务**:

-**核心义务**:乙方需组建专业团队,严格按照合同约定完成课程设计,包括但不限于:

-在30日内提交初步的课程框架方案,经甲方审核通过后进入开发阶段;

-在90日内完成全部案例研究与实验环境配置,确保案例覆盖Spark的核心功能(如RDD、SparkSQL、Streaming等);

-提供至少20小时的教师培训,涵盖案例操作、技术原理及常见问题解决方案;

-交付完整的课程材料,包括但不限于:10份PPT、5套实验手册(含代码示例)、3份技术参考文档;

-**质量保证**:乙方需保证交付的课程材料原创性,不得侵犯第三方知识产权,并提供1年的技术维护服务,响应时间不超过24小时;

-**保密义务**:乙方应对甲方提供的敏感信息(如教学计划、学生数据等)严格保密,未经甲方书面许可不得泄露给任何第三方;

-**知识产权**:乙方交付的课程材料中包含的软件代码及部分案例设计归乙方所有,但甲方有权在课程教学中使用。如需商业化开发,需另行签订授权协议;

-**进度管理**:乙方应定期向甲方汇报项目进展,至少每2周提交一次书面报告,如遇延期需提前5日书面说明原因,并采取补救措施。

双方均应遵守上述权利与义务,任何违约行为均需承担相应的法律责任。本条款为双方合作的基础,需严格履行,以确保项目目标的实现。

第四条价格与支付条件

本合同项下“基于Spark的实时日志分析案例研究课程设计”项目的总费用为人民币贰拾万元整(¥200,000.00)。该费用包含但不限于课程框架设计、案例研究开发、实验环境搭建方案、技术指导与培训、课程材料交付等所有合同约定的服务内容。

支付方式采用分期付款,具体安排如下:

1.**预付款**:本合同签订后7日内,甲方向乙方支付总费用的30%,即人民币陆万元整(¥60,000.00)。乙方在收到款项后需向甲方开具等额发票。

2.**进度款**:乙方完成全部课程材料初稿并通过甲方初步验收后10日内,甲方向乙方支付总费用的40%,即人民币捌万元整(¥80,000.00)。乙方在收到款项后需向甲方开具等额发票。

3.**尾款**:乙方完成全部课程设计并通过甲方最终验收后15日内,甲方向乙方支付剩余的总费用的30%,即人民币陆万元整(¥60,000.00)。乙方在收到款项后需向甲方开具等额发票。

如甲方未按本条款约定支付款项,每逾期一日,应向乙方支付逾期款项千分之五的违约金,逾期超过30日,乙方有权暂停项目交付或解除合同,并要求甲方支付已完成工作的80%作为违约补偿。

第五条履行期限

本合同项下项目的整体履行期限为120日,自本合同签订之日起计算。具体时间节点安排如下:

1.**合同签订后30日内**:乙方提交初步的课程框架方案,甲方在收到后15日内完成审核并反馈意见。

2.**合同签订后60日内**:乙方完成全部案例研究开发与实验环境搭建方案,并提交甲方进行初步验收。甲方在收到后20日内完成初步验收并反馈意见。

3.**合同签订后90日内**:乙方根据甲方反馈意见完成最终的课程材料修改,并对甲方教师进行技术培训(培训时间不少于20小时)。甲方在收到后15日内完成最终验收。

4.**合同签订后120日内**:乙方完成所有项目交付物,并配合甲方完成项目总结。如因甲方原因导致进度延误(如未及时提供需求资料、未按时反馈意见等),乙方履行期限自动顺延,甲方需承担相应责任。

本合同自双方签字盖章之日起生效,至项目最终验收完成且所有款项结清之日终止。期间产生的知识产权归属、保密责任等按本合同约定执行。

第六条违约责任

**一、甲方违约责任**

1.**未按时支付款项**:如甲方未按第四条约定支付任何一期款项,每逾期一日,应向乙方支付逾期金额千分之五的违约金。逾期超过30日,乙方有权解除合同,并要求甲方支付已完成工作的80%作为违约补偿,同时保留追究甲方逾期付款利息及直接损失的权利。

2.**需求变更不当**:甲方在项目进行中提出超出合同范围的重大需求变更,应承担由此增加的费用(包括但不限于额外开发成本、延期费用等),且乙方有权要求甲方支付变更部分50%的预付款。若甲方拒绝支付,乙方有权拒绝执行变更需求。

3.**验收拖延**:如甲方无正当理由拖延最终验收超过30日,视为甲方接受乙方交付成果,并自动结清所有款项。同时,乙方保留向甲方主张项目期间的合理利润及机会损失的权利。

**二、乙方违约责任**

1.**未按时交付核心成果**:如乙方未按第五条约定时间节点交付关键成果(如初步框架方案、最终课程材料等),每逾期一日,应向甲方支付合同总金额千分之五的违约金。逾期超过30日,甲方有权解除合同,并要求乙方退还已支付款项的50%作为违约金,同时乙方需赔偿甲方因此造成的直接损失(包括但不限于寻找替代供应商的费用、课程延期对学生的影响等)。

2.**质量不符合约定**:乙方交付的课程材料存在严重质量问题(如技术错误导致无法运行、案例设计不符合教学目标、知识产权侵权等),甲方有权要求乙方在30日内修正。若乙方拒绝修正或修正后仍不合格,甲方有权解除合同,并要求乙方退还全部已付款项,并赔偿甲方合同总金额的30%作为违约金。

3.**泄露保密信息**:如乙方或其工作人员故意或因重大过失泄露甲方提供的商业秘密或教学资料,应向甲方支付合同总金额的50%作为违约金,并承担相应的法律责任(包括但不限于诉讼费、律师费等)。若该泄露行为对甲方造成直接经济损失,乙方需另行赔偿。

4.**培训责任不履行**:乙方未按约定提供技术培训或培训质量严重不合格,甲方有权要求乙方在15日内补充培训。若乙方仍不履行,甲方有权解除合同,并要求乙方退还已支付款项的70%作为违约金。

**三、不可抗力免责**

若任何一方因不可抗力(如战争、自然灾害、法律政策变更等)导致无法履行合同义务,应在事件发生后7日内书面通知对方,并提供相关证明。双方应根据不可抗力影响程度协商调整履行期限或部分免除责任,但不可抗力导致的直接损失仍需承担赔偿责任。

**四、违约金上限**

本合同项下所有违约金总额不超过合同总金额的150%,超过部分甲方有权放弃。任何一方违约时,守约方除要求违约金外,还有权要求赔偿实际损失,包括直接损失与可预期利益损失。

**五、争议优先解决**

若因违约行为引发争议,违约方应在收到守约方书面违约通知后30日内采取补救措施,否则守约方有权直接向法院提起诉讼或申请仲裁,违约方需承担由此产生的全部法律费用。

第七条不可抗力

**一、不可抗力定义**

本合同所称“不可抗力”是指不能预见、不能避免并不能克服的客观情况,包括但不限于:

1.**自然灾害**:地震、台风、洪水、雷击、火山爆发、海啸等严重自然灾害;

2.**战争行为**:军事冲突、武装起义、恐怖袭击、罢工、暴乱等类似事件;

3.**政府行为**:法律法规的变更、行政命令、政策调整等政府行为;

4.**疫情及其他公共卫生事件**:如传染病爆发、政府隔离措施等导致业务中断的情形;

5.**技术故障**:非因一方过错导致的系统瘫痪、网络中断等不可归责于任何方的技术事故。

**二、不可抗力责任免除**

1.**暂停履行**:如发生不可抗力事件,受影响方应在事件发生后7日内书面通知对方,说明不可抗力的影响范围及预计持续时间,并采取措施减少损失。双方应根据不可抗力影响程度协商是否暂停履行合同部分或全部义务。

2.**责任界定**:不可抗力导致合同无法履行的,受影响方不承担违约责任,但需提供相关证明文件(如政府部门公告、保险理赔证明等)。若不可抗力仅导致部分延迟履行,延迟期限可相应顺延,且延迟期间双方均不承担违约责任。

3.**合同解除**:若不可抗力持续超过60日,双方可协商解除合同。解除后,已履行部分的费用按实际贡献比例结算,未履行部分不再承担责任。

4.**损失承担**:因不可抗力造成的直接损失(如已付款项的不可退还部分)由双方根据过错程度分担,间接损失(如机会损失)原则上由受影响方自行承担。

5.**不可免除条款**:即使发生不可抗力,双方仍需履行保密、知识产权保护等非依赖具体履行的条款,且应尽到合理的减损义务。

第八条争议解决

**一、争议解决原则**

双方因本合同引起的或与本合同有关的任何争议,应首先通过友好协商解决;协商不成的,任何一方均有权选择以下第(一)项或第(二)项方式解决。

**二、争议解决方式**

(一)**仲裁**:向中国国际经济贸易仲裁委员会(CIETAC),按照申请仲裁时该会现行有效的仲裁规则进行仲裁。仲裁地点为甲方所在地(XX市),仲裁语言为中文。仲裁裁决是终局的,对双方均有约束力,仲裁费用由败诉方承担。

(二)**诉讼**:向甲方所在地有管辖权的人民法院提起诉讼。诉讼过程中,双方应积极配合提供证据材料,且诉讼期间不影响合同的继续履行(除非双方另有约定)。

**三、证据规则**

双方应保存与争议相关的全部证据,并按对方要求在合理期限内提供。如一方无法提供关键证据,将承担不利后果。

**四、争议前置条件**

在仲裁或诉讼前,任何一方不得单方面向第三方主张权利或采取财产保全措施,但紧急情况除外。若一方已采取行动,应立即通知对方并说明理由,否则对方有权要求其承担相应责任。

**五、管辖唯一性**

除本条款明确约定外,双方不得就本合同项下的任何争议达成其他管辖协议,任何试通过其他途径解决争议的行为均无效。本条款构成双方关于争议解决的完整协议,取代此前所有口头或书面约定。

第九条其他条款

**一、通知方式**

双方之间的所有通知、请求、要求或其他通信均应以书面形式(包括但不限于信函、传真、电子邮件)发送至本合同首部列明的地址或联系方式。如一方变更联系方式,应提前10日书面通知对方。以电子邮件方式发送的,发出时视为送达;以快递或挂号信方式发送的,寄出后3日视为送达。

**二、合同变更**

对本合同的任何修改或补充,均需经双方授权代表书面签署补充协议方可生效。补充协议与本合同具有同等法律效力,且不得与本合同约定相抵触。任何口头约定或非

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论